DESCRIPTION
There is currently one (1) vacancy for Water Reclamation Operator I / II / III Flex. The Department desires to fill the position at the level of an Operator III; however, the eligibility list established from this recruitment may be used to fill current and future vacancies as they occur at any level of the series.
Water Reclamation Operator I : $5,002 - $6,080 monthly
Water Reclamation Operator II : $6,107 - $7,423 monthly
Water Reclamation Operator III : $7,455 - $9,062 monthly
Employees will receive $500.00 per month for earning a grade four (4) Wastewater Treatment Plant Operator certification or $1,025.00 per month for earning a grade five (5) Wastewater Treatment Plant Operator Certification from the State of California's Water Resources Control Board.

Knowledge & Education
- Equivalent to completion of the twelfth (12th) grade, supplemented by college level coursework in water reclamation treatment technology or a related field.
- Knowledge of principles of wastewater treatment and water reclamation processes including conventional activated sludge, enhanced primary treatment, extended aeration, membrane bioreactor, anaerobic digestion, dewatering, biosolids drying, and ditch processes.
- Knowledge of relevant chemicals used in water reclamation.
- Knowledge of supervisory control and data acquisition systems (SCADA).

Community
A City whose heritage spans more than a century, the City of Corona, located in Riverside County, California, encompasses around 40 square miles and has a vibrant, culturally diverse population of approximately 168,100 residents. Residents of Corona enjoy a variety of cultural, recreational, and educational opportunities that provide a first-rate quality of life for its residents and visitors. Within an hour's travel time, outdoor enthusiasts can enjoy such winter activities as snowboarding and skiing and such summer activities as surfing, boating, or simply relaxing on a beach. Corona's economy is strong and getting stronger; more than 84,000 people work here. Our retail, commercial, and housing areas are expanding, and office development continues to be strong.
The Organization
The City of Corona is a General Law city operating under a Council-Manager form of government. Policymaking and legislative authority is vested in the City Council, consisting of a Mayor and four Council Members. Members of the City Council are elected by District to a four-year term. The Mayor is selected by the Council and serves as the presiding officer for one year.
The City is organized into the following departments / organizational units : Community Services, City Manager's Office, Economic Development, Finance, Fire, Human Resources, Information Technology, Legal and Risk Management, Police, Planning & Development, Public Works and Utilities. Oversight of these departments is divided between the City Manager and two Assistant City Managers.
The City's total operating budget for Fiscal Year 2025 is $ 399.1 million with a General Fund operating budget of $ 209.6 million. Corona enjoys a workforce of 922 dedicated employees who provide high quality services to its residents and visitors each day.
